House for sale near Sliven

We are offering to your attention another traditional revival house for sale located in an amazing area just near Kotel.

The property is situated in a picturesque village included in Kotel municipality, Sliven district. It is just 10 km south from the town of Kotel and 50 km from Sliven. The village is small and quiet but with all necessary amenities and communication, including regular public transport.

The offered house is fully renovation situated in a nice place in the village. It benefits from system for central heating, new window joineries. The house is two-storied with total living area of 140 sq m. It consists of three bedrooms, three bathrooms with WCs, kitchen, living room and a spacious quest room.

The yard is 305 sq m in size. In the yard there is a small building - a summer kitchen. There is also a barbeque and a shed, as well a storage premise. The house has wonderful view towards the village.
